In India, the food industry is strictly regulated in order to ensure food safety and quality. Food safety standards are supervised by Food Safety and Standards Authority of India (FSSAI). For packaged food businesses, achieving FSSAI certification is not just a legal requirement but a sign of credibility. This blog examines why FSSAI certification is necessary for packaged food businesses.
1. Legal Requirement
FSSAI certification is highly mandatory for all food businesses. Operating a packaged food business without this license can lead to legal action, heavy fines or even closure of the business.
2. Ensures Food Safety & Quality
FSSAI sets strict guidelines for hygiene, storage, and packaging to maintain the quality of food. This certification ensures that the packaged food is safe, unadulterated and meets the prescribed standards.
3. Builds Consumer Trust
Consumers are more conscious about food safety today. FSSAI certification of packaged food products assures consumers that the food is safe for consumption, enhancing brand trust and reputation.
4. Helps in Business Growth & Market Expansion
With FSSAI certification, businesses can sell their products throughout India without restrictions. This enables companies to export packaged food products and opens doors to global markets.
5. Boosts Brand Reputation
A brand with FSSAI certification is reliable and trustworthy. This certification acts as a marketing tool, helping businesses to gain consumer confidence and stand out from competitors.
6. Avoids Penalties & Legal Issues
Failure to comply with FSSAI regulations can result in fines, product recalls and legal complications. Certification ensures your business complies with food safety regulations.
